<strong>Crime</strong> & Criminals Tracking Network and Systems ProjectNagaland PoliceLaw & Order Maintenance, Investigation, <strong>Crime</strong> Prevention, and Traffic Management are corecomponents of policing work. Information technology can both enable and improve theeffectiveness and efficiency of the core activities of the police. Police should be provided with dataamenable for easier and faster analysis in order to enable them to make better and informeddecisions.iv. Increase Operational EfficiencyPolice should spend more time on the public facing functions. Information technology solutionsshould help in reducing the repetitive paperwork/records and making the back-office functionsmore efficient.v. Create a platform for sharing crime & criminal information across the countryThere is a critical need to create a platform for sharing crime and criminal information acrosspolice stations within and between the different states in order to increase the effectiveness indealing with criminals across the state borders.vi. Eliminating Drudgery from Police SystemInstitutionalization of a platform to share information seamlessly with other states and otherdepartments would rely on the central repository of information regarding crime and criminals.This central repository would be a step-stone towards efficient policing by reducing drudgery fromthe system and allowing police to spend more time in activities related to crime prevention andcrime investigation.3.3 Stakeholders of ProjectThe impact of the police subject being sensitive, a consultative and a bottom-up approach has to beadopted in designing the MMP impacting the following stakeholders:• Citizens/ Citizens groups (People of Nagaland , Other citizens of India & Foreignnationals)• MHA/NCRB/Others• State Police department, CID, CBI, etc.• Employees of Nagaland Police• External Departments of the State such as Jails, Courts, Passport Office, TransportDepartment and Hospitals etc.• Non-Government/Private sector organizations<strong>Volume</strong> I Request for Proposal for Selection of System Integrator Page 12 of 193
